All posts
Technical Implementation

Technische Umsetzung: Expert Guide 2026 – 546 – Optimierung für Inklusion und Barrierefreiheit

Die zunehmende Komplexität moderner Webanwendungen und die strengeren gesetzlichen Anforderungen (wie die EAA 2026 in Deutschland) stellen Entwickler vor...

ATAccessio Team
4 minutes read

Die zunehmende Komplexität moderner Webanwendungen und die strengeren gesetzlichen Anforderungen (wie die EAA 2026 in Deutschland) stellen Entwickler vor neue Herausforderungen bei der Barrierefreiheit. Viele Projekte scheitern nicht an fehlendem Willen, sondern an mangelndem Fachwissen und effizienten Werkzeugen. Dieser Artikel beleuchtet die technischen Aspekte der Barrierefreiheit im Jahr 2026 und bietet eine detaillierte Anleitung für eine erfolgreiche Umsetzung.

Die Herausforderungen der Barrierefreiheit im Jahr 2026

Die EAA 2026 hat die Messlatte höher gelegt. Die Anforderungen an die Barrierefreiheit von Websites und Anwendungen sind klarer definiert und die Kontrollen werden strenger. Dies betrifft insbesondere die korrekte Verwendung von ARIA-Labels, die Optimierung für Screenreader und eine intuitive Keyboard-Navigation.

Die EAA 2026 fordert unter anderem eine detailliertere Prüfung der Farbkombinationen und die Bereitstellung von Textalternativen für nicht-textliche Inhalte.

Die manuelle Prüfung auf Barrierefreiheit ist zeitaufwendig und fehleranfällig. Automatisierte Tools können lediglich einen Teil der Probleme erkennen. Die Kombination aus manueller Prüfung und automatisierten Tools ist daher unerlässlich.

ARIA-Labels: Die Grundlage für Screenreader-Kompatibilität

ARIA (Accessible Rich Internet Applications) ist ein Satz von Attributen, die verwendet werden, um die Semantik von Webinhalten für Screenreader und andere assistive Technologien zu verbessern. ARIA-Labels sind entscheidend, um Benutzern die Bedeutung und Funktion von Elementen zu vermitteln, die semantisch unklar sind.

Ein häufiges Problem ist die Verwendung von JavaScript-basierten Widgets, die von Screenreadern nicht nativ verstanden werden. In solchen Fällen müssen ARIA-Attribute verwendet werden, um die Rolle, den Status und die Eigenschaften des Widgets zu definieren.

Best Practices für ARIA-Labels

  • Verwenden Sie präzise und aussagekräftige Beschreibungen.
  • Vermeiden Sie redundante Informationen.
  • Achten Sie auf die Konsistenz der Beschreibungen.
  • Testen Sie die Beschreibungen mit verschiedenen Screenreadern.

Ein Beispiel: Ein interaktives Karussell benötigt ein ARIA-Label, das seine aktuelle Position und die Anzahl der Elemente angibt.

<div role="region" aria-label="Karussell: Aktuelles Bild von 5" id="meinKarussell">
  <!-- Inhalt des Karussells -->
</div>

Screenreader-Optimierung: Mehr als nur ARIA

Die Optimierung für Screenreader geht über die reine Verwendung von ARIA hinaus. Es geht darum, eine intuitive und logische Benutzererfahrung für Menschen mit Sehbehinderungen zu schaffen.

Wichtige Aspekte der Screenreader-Optimierung

  • Korrekte HTML-Struktur: Verwenden Sie semantische HTML-Elemente (z.B. <header>, <nav>, <main>, <footer>) für eine klare Struktur.
  • Fokus-Management: Stellen Sie sicher, dass der Fokus in der logischen Reihenfolge durch die Seite bewegt wird.
  • Alternative Texte für Bilder: Beschreiben Sie den Inhalt und die Funktion von Bildern mit präzisen alt-Attributen.
  • Headings: Verwenden Sie Headings (<h1> - <h6>) zur Strukturierung des Inhalts.

Fallstudie: Eine E-Commerce-Website

Eine E-Commerce-Website hatte Probleme mit der Navigation für Screenreader-Benutzer. Die Produktfilter waren nicht korrekt mit ARIA-Attributen versehen, was zu Verwirrung und Frustration führte. Nach der Implementierung korrekter ARIA-Labels und einer verbesserten Fokus-Reihenfolge konnte die Benutzerfreundlichkeit deutlich verbessert werden.

Keyboard-Navigation: Barrierefreiheit für Alle

Die Keyboard-Navigation ist ein wesentlicher Bestandteil der Barrierefreiheit. Sie ermöglicht es Benutzern, eine Website oder Anwendung ohne Maus zu bedienen. Dies ist besonders wichtig für Menschen mit motorischen Einschränkungen.

Best Practices für die Keyboard-Navigation

  • Stellen Sie sicher, dass alle interaktiven Elemente (Links, Buttons, Formularfelder) mit der Tab-Taste erreichbar sind.
  • Definieren Sie eine klare Fokus-Reihenfolge.
  • Verwenden Sie sichtbare Fokus-Indikatoren.
  • Vermeiden Sie "Fokus-Fallen", in denen der Fokus in einem Element verloren geht.

Ein häufiges Problem sind modale Dialogfenster, die den Fokus "fangen" und den Benutzer daran hindern, die Hauptseite zu verlassen. Die Implementierung einer korrekten Fokus-Management-Strategie ist hier entscheidend.

Automatisierung und KI im Bereich Barrierefreiheit

Die manuelle Prüfung auf Barrierefreiheit ist zeitaufwendig und teuer. Im Jahr 2026 spielen automatisierte Tools und insbesondere KI-gestützte Lösungen eine immer größere Rolle.

Wir haben festgestellt, dass die Einführung von KI-basierten Tools die Zeit für die Identifizierung und Behebung von Barrierefreiheitsproblemen um bis zu 60% reduziert.

Accessio.ai ist ein Beispiel für ein solches Tool. Es analysiert den Quellcode und identifiziert Barrierefreiheitsprobleme, die von traditionellen Scannern oft übersehen werden. Im Gegensatz zu Overlay-Lösungen, die lediglich die Darstellung von Inhalten verändern, behebt Accessio.ai die Probleme direkt im Quellcode.

Integration von Accessio.ai in den Entwicklungsprozess

Die Integration von Accessio.ai in den Entwicklungsprozess ist einfach und unkompliziert. Das Tool kann in die CI/CD-Pipeline integriert werden, um Barrierefreiheitsprobleme frühzeitig zu erkennen und zu beheben.

Vorteile der Integration

  • Frühzeitige Erkennung von Barrierefreiheitsproblemen.
  • Reduzierung der Kosten für die Behebung von Problemen.
  • Verbesserung der Qualität des Codes.
  • Kontinuierliche Überwachung der Barrierefreiheit.

Key Takeaways

  • Die EAA 2026 stellt neue Anforderungen an die Barrierefreiheit.
  • ARIA-Labels sind entscheidend für die Screenreader-Kompatibilität.
  • Die Optimierung für Screenreader erfordert mehr als nur ARIA.
  • Keyboard-Navigation ist ein wesentlicher Bestandteil der Barrierefreiheit.
  • KI-gestützte Tools wie Accessio.ai können den Entwicklungsprozess effizienter gestalten und die Qualität der Barrierefreiheit verbessern.

Next Steps

  • Überprüfen Sie Ihre Website oder Anwendung auf EAA 2026-Konformität. Nutzen Sie eine Kombination aus manuellen Prüfungen und automatisierten Tools.
  • Bilden Sie Ihre Entwickler im Bereich Barrierefreiheit weiter.
  • Integrieren Sie ein KI-gestütztes Barrierefreiheitstool wie Accessio.ai in Ihren Entwicklungsprozess.
  • Testen Sie Ihre Website oder Anwendung mit Screenreadern und anderen assistiven Technologien.
  • Erstellen Sie einen Plan zur kontinuierlichen Verbesserung der Barrierefreiheit. Implementieren Sie regelmäßige Audits und Schulungen.
Technische Umsetzung: Expert Guide 2026 – 546 – Optimierung für Inklusion und Barrierefreiheit | AccessioAI